Our client is one of the world's largest suppliers of conveyor pulleys, with manufacturing facilities in Ireland and China producing in excess of 50,000 pulleys annually.

This is a family-run business with over 30 years of experience in manufacturing conveyor pulleys. With their ever-expanding client base, they are currently expanding their headquarters in Ireland to be able to meet increasing demand.

JOB DETAILS:

Job Title: Machine Operative (Manual Lathe)

Work Location: Dungannon, Co. Tyrone

Reports To: Shift Team Leader/Production Supervisor

Job Purpose: To operate machine to manufacture required components in line with production schedule.

Schedule: It is a 40hr week, with a 15-minute paid tea break and a 30-minute unpaid lunch break and 4 shift patterns:

  1. Morning shifts: 6am to 3pm Mon to Thurs and Fri 6am to 12noon
  2. 7am to 4pm Mon to Thurs and Fri 7am to 1pm
  3. Day Shift: 8am to 5pm Mon to Thurs and Fri 8am 2pm
  4. Evening Shift: 3pm to 11:40pm Mon to Thurs and Fri 12noon to 6pm

Salary: £11.85 - 12.50 per hour

  • A range of other employee benefits.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• To correctly operate machine to manufacture component parts for production, to required quality standard in accordance with work instruction provided.
  • To read, understand and correctly implement technical drawings.
  • To handle, transport and store component parts as per training and instruction.
  • To maintain work equipment and a safe and well-organised workstation.
  • To complete daily safety checks to ensure machine and work equipment is in good working order and submit all necessary check sheets as required.
  • To follow instructions provided by Supervisor.
  • To work in accordance with relevant Risk Assessments & safe systems of work (SSOWs) and standard operating procedures (SOPs), as per training and instruction.
  • To comply with company policies and procedures.
  • Any other duties, within reason and capability, as agreed with the General Manager / Supervisor.

PERSON SPECIFICATION:

  • Good standard of education to GCSE level or equivalent.
  • A strong work ethic.
  • Ability to read technical drawings.
  • Ability to read and use measuring tools.
  • Previous experience of operating work machinery.
  • Operational use of Cranes, Air & Hand Tools.
